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 30 mins
Total Time: 40 mins
Cuisine: Indian
Serves: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 1 cup chickpeas (cooked or canned)
  2. 1 cup lentils (red or green)
  3. 1 onion, diced
  4. 2 garlic cloves, minced
  5. 1 tbsp ginger, grated
  6. 2 cups diced tomatoes (canned or fresh)
  7. 1 can coconut milk
  8. 2 tbsp curry powder
  9. Salt and pepper to taste
  10. Fresh cilantro for garnish

Instructions

  1. Begin by preparing your ingredients. If using dried chickpeas, soak them overnight and cook them until tender. If using canned chickpeas, simply drain and rinse them. Rinse the lentils under cold water until the water runs clear.
  2. In a large pot or deep skillet, heat a tablespoon of oil over medium heat. Once hot, add the diced onion and sauté for about 5 minutes, or until the onion becomes translucent and fragrant.
  3. Add the minced garlic and grated ginger to the pot. Continue to sauté for an additional 1-2 minutes, stirring frequently to prevent burning.
  4. Stir in the curry powder, allowing it to cook for about 30 seconds to release its flavors, stirring constantly.
  5. Add the diced tomatoes to the pot, along with the cooked chickpeas and lentils. Stir well to combine all the ingredients.
  6. Pour in the coconut milk, and season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ir the mixture thoroughly to ensure everything is well incorporated.
  7. Bring the curry to a gentle simmer, then reduce the heat to low. Cover the pot and let it cook for about 20-25 minutes, stirring occasionally. This allows the flavors to meld together.
  8. Once the curry has thickened and the lentils are tender, ta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ary. If you prefer a thinner consistency, feel free to add a little water or vegetable broth.
  9. Remove the pot from heat and let it sit for a few minutes. Serve the curry hot, garnished with fresh cilantro on top.
  10. This chickpea and lentil curry pairs beautifully with rice, quinoa, or naan bread. Enjoy your delicious and nutritious vegan meal!

Tips

  1. For the most authentic flavor, use freshly ground curry powder or make your own spice blend.
  2. If possible, use dried chickpeas and soak them overnight for better texture and digestibility.
  3. Don't rush the sautéing of onions, garlic, and ginger - this builds the flavor foundation of your curry.
  4. Toast your curry powder briefly to enhance its aromatic qualities before adding other ingredients.
  5. For a creamier consistency, you can blend a portion of the curry and mix it back in.
  6. Choose full-fat coconut milk for a richer, more luxurious sauce.
  7. Let the curry sit for 10-15 minutes after cooking to allow flavors to fully develop.
  8. Garnish with fresh cilantro and a squeeze of lime for a bright, fresh finish.
